Compact transversely diode-pumped Nd :YAG laser with a self-pumped phase-conjugate multiloop cavity

A compact high-power repetitively pulsed Nd :YAG laser with transverse diode pumping and a multiloop self-pumped phase-conjugate cavity is presented. The obtained pulse trains have an energy of 2.55 J with beam quality M{sup 2}⩽1.2, a divergence of 0.35 mrad, and a spatial brightness of 7×10{sup 14} W cm{sup −2} sr{sup −1}. The peak power of single-frequency pulses exceeds 21 MW at a pulse energy of 230 mJ. The laser bandwidth is 300 MHz. (lasers)
